Java and C++ in Today's Tech Landscape
Java and C++ have been around for decades, and while they have evolved, their core principles remain largely the same. Java is known for its portability and object-oriented nature, making it ideal for applications that run across different platforms. C++, on the other hand, is a more complex, lower-level language that is often used for systems programming and applications requiring high-performance computing. In 2025, both languages continue to be pillars in the software industry, with Java widely used for web development, Android apps, and enterprise applications, and C++ being vital in fields like gaming, embedded systems, and large-scale applications.
For students, it’s essential to recognize the value of mastering both languages, as they offer distinct benefits. Java, with its "write once, run anywhere" philosophy, is great for applications that need to run across various platforms. C++, while more complex, provides a deeper understanding of how computers work, including memory management and hardware-level control. This makes C++ an ideal choice for students interested in building high-performance software or working with resource-constrained systems.

Java vs. C++: Which Should You Learn First?
For beginners, the question often arises: Should you start with Java or C++? The answer largely depends on your interests and goals. Java’s simpler syntax and built-in garbage collection make it an excellent starting point for those new to programming. If you're interested in building web applications, mobile apps, or enterprise software, Java should be your go-to language. On the other hand, if you’re more inclined toward game development, systems programming, or want a deeper understanding of how computers work, C++ is an essential language to learn.
Both languages complement each other in their own ways. While learning one first might provide immediate benefits, learning both Java and C++ over time will make you a well-rounded developer with the skills to tackle a broader range of programming tasks. Challenges Students Face When Learning Java and C++
While Java and C++ are both valuable languages to learn, students often face various challenges in mastering them. For Java, the primary hurdle is understanding the intricacies of its object-oriented nature, such as inheritance, polymorphism, and interfaces. For C++, students frequently struggle with more complex concepts like manual memory management, pointers, and advanced data structures.
